Call of Duty Warzone Release

Call of Duty’s new battle royale (Warzone) is most likely to release this Tuesday, March 3rd or A week from them on March 10th. Either way this mode is long awaited for many fans as Modern Warfare has felt stale as of late. I also want to point out that all of these topics I am going to bring up are more rumoured and leaked, rather than factual. None of this is a proven thing, even though they are most likely going to be true.

First things first, the lobby size. Warzone is most liekly going to be a much bigger Battle Royale than we have seen. It is going to have a 200 player space lobby. That is double of what Blackout and Fortnite have. That large lobby size comes into play with the map size. It is rumored that the map will be huge and will consist of all the Spec Ops maps combined into one entire area. The concern behind this is that maybe the games will move too slow. With the bigger map comes more time spent getting to the next zone and a big part of your game is just running.

It is also interesting to see how big the update file will be considering if the map is all the spec ops maps combined then it will be a very large update file. That could cause the community to get a little bit angry, but as long as the servers stay strong and there aren’t too many bugs, then it will be good. The interesting things about Warzone will be what attachments are in the game and if all guns are in the mode as well. No matter what happens, I am excited for this update coming soon… Hopefully.
